Indian MoS Pabitra Margherita begins Latin America tour

Minister of State for External Affairs Pabitra Margherita is set to embark on his first official foreign visit to five countries from August 15 to 24. During this tour, he will travel to the Dominican Republic, Guatemala, El Salvador, Panama, and Trinidad & Tobago.

Minister of State for External Affairs Pabitra Margherita is set to embark on his first official foreign visit to five countries from August 15 to 24. During this tour, he will travel to the Dominican Republic, Guatemala, El Salvador, Panama, and Trinidad & Tobago.

 

This significant visit aims to strengthen India’s diplomatic ties and explore new areas of cooperation with these nations in the Latin American and Caribbean regions.

 

The journey begins with a two-day visit to the Dominican Republic on August 15-16. Here, Margherita will attend the formal swearing-in ceremony of President-elect Luis Abinader and engage with members of the Indian diaspora. This visit underscores the growing relationship between India and the Dominican Republic, marked by mutual respect and shared interests.

 

Following this, Margherita will head to Guatemala from August 17-19. During his stay, he will meet with President Cesar Bernardo Arevalo de Leon and hold a bilateral meeting with Foreign Minister Carlos Ramiro Martinez.

 

The discussions are expected to focus on enhancing bilateral ties, particularly in trade, investment, and cultural exchange. Margherita will also interact with members of the Chamber of Industry of Guatemala and the Committee of Agricultural, Commercial, Industrial, and Financial Associations (CACIF). Additionally, he will visit Antigua, a UNESCO Heritage city, reflecting India’s appreciation for Guatemala’s rich cultural heritage.

 

On August 19, Margherita will make a brief visit to El Salvador, where he is scheduled to meet President Nayib Bukele and Foreign Minister Alexandra Hill T. The visit aims to bolster bilateral relations, with discussions likely to cover areas such as trade, technology, and cultural exchanges. Margherita will also engage with the Indian diaspora, further strengthening the bond between the two nations.

 

Margherita’s tour will then take him to Panama from August 20-22. In Panama, he will engage in delegation-level talks with Foreign Minister Javier Martinez and meet with President Jose Raul Mulino.

 

A highlight of the visit will be his tribute to Mahatma Gandhi at the University of Panama, symbolising India’s enduring commitment to peace and non-violence.

 

Margherita will also visit the Panama Canal and the Panama Pacifico Free Trade Zone, key hubs of international trade, to explore opportunities for enhancing economic cooperation between the two countries.

 

The final leg of Margherita’s tour will be in Trinidad & Tobago from August 23-24. Here, he will meet with Prime Minister Dr. Keith Rowley and Foreign & CARICOM Affairs Minister Dr. Amery Browne.

 

The discussions are expected to focus on deepening India’s engagement with the Caribbean nation, particularly in areas such as trade, education, and cultural exchange. Margherita will also interact with the Indian community, underscoring India’s commitment to its diaspora.

 

This visit by Margherita is a clear indication of India’s intent to strengthen its ties with the Latin American and Caribbean regions. The tour offers an opportunity to explore new areas of mutual interest and to further India’s global diplomatic presence. The visit also reflects India’s commitment to fostering strong, multifaceted relationships with countries across the globe.
